Health Benefits: It's Not Just About Weight Loss
The health benefits of a plant-based diet are extensive. Beyond just helping with weight management, it can reduce the risk of heart disease, certain cancers, and diabetes. By incorporating whole plant foods into my diet, I felt a noticeable improvement in my digestion, thanks to the high fiber content in these foods.
What's more, a plant-based diet is typically lower in saturated fat, which can help keep your heart healthy. Plus, the rich array of antioxidants in plant foods can help protect against certain types of cancer. As someone who values their health, these benefits were a game-changer for me.
Saving Our Home: The Environmental Angle
Embracing a plant-based diet isn't just about personal health; it's also a powerful way to combat environmental issues. As per a United Nations report, animal agriculture is a significant contributor to greenhouse gas emissions, deforestation, and water pollution.
By adopting a plant-based diet, I realized that I could significantly reduce my environmental footprint. It felt incredible to know that my dietary choices could make such a positive difference in the world we live in.
Budget-Friendly and Accessible
One of my initial concerns was whether a plant-based diet would be too costly. However, I discovered that this was a common misconception. Ingredients such as legumes, grains, and seasonal produce are both affordable and easily available at most supermarkets.
Plenty of online resources guided me on how to make healthy, satisfying plant-based meals without breaking the bank.
